Seas given as significant wave height, which is the average
height of the highest 1/3 of the waves. Individual waves may be
more than twice the significant wave height.

Synopsis for the E Pacific within 250 nm of Central America,
Colombia, and within 750 nm of Ecuador
848 PM PDT Tue Jul 1 2025

.SYNOPSIS...Fresh to locally strong NE to E winds will pulse
across the Papagayo region through Thu night due to the pressure
gradient between a ridge to the N and lower pressure along the
monsoon trough. Elsewhere, gentle to moderate winds and moderate
seas in southerly swell are expected. Moderate to rough cross
equatorial S to SW swell will affect the waters near the
Galapagos Islands into Thu. Moderate or weaker winds are forecast
across the entire region over the weekend.
